What affects the cost

This checklist covers the main factors that affect scope and price.

  • FENSA or CERTASS certification and Building Regulations compliance
  • Window style, such as casement, sash, tilt-and-turn or bay
  • Condition of the existing frames, lintels and surrounding brickwork
  • Whether trickle vents are required to meet ventilation regulations
  • Whether bay or bow windows need additional structural support
  • Lead time for made-to-measure frames, especially bespoke shapes
  • Frame material, such as uPVC, timber, aluminium or composite

Listed building window restrictions

Listed building consent is usually required to replace windows in a listed property, and uPVC replacements are often refused — timber matching the original profile is typically required instead. Conservation areas have similar restrictions even where the property isn't individually listed. Check with your local planning authority before ordering anything.

Warm edge spacers, a small detail that matters

The spacer bar between glazing panes affects both thermal performance and condensation risk at the edge of the glass — modern "warm edge" spacers perform better than older aluminium spacer bars. Worth asking which type is specified, particularly for a north-facing or otherwise cold room.

Door thresholds and accessibility

Standard door thresholds have a small step; low-profile or level thresholds are available for step-free access, worth requesting specifically if accessibility is a factor, since they're not always the default option quoted unless asked for directly.

Building Regulations Part L and your windows

Part L sets minimum energy efficiency standards for replacement windows and doors — a maximum U-value the glazing must meet. A FENSA or CERTASS registered installer certifies this automatically as part of the job; an unregistered installer means arranging a separate council building control inspection and paying its fee yourself.

Window replacement in flats and shared buildings

In a leasehold flat, window replacement sometimes needs freeholder or management company permission, particularly if it affects the building's external appearance — check your lease before booking work, not after ordering.

Security ratings and multi-point locking

Modern replacement windows and doors use multi-point locking as standard, and some are tested to PAS 24 security standards — worth asking about specifically if security is a priority, since not every installer fits PAS 24-rated hardware by default even on similar-looking frames.

How the quote and survey process works

An initial quote is usually based on rough measurements and photos; a firm price follows an in-person survey, since window openings in older properties are rarely perfectly square or a standard size. Made-to-measure lead times are typically 2-6 weeks after survey, before installation is booked in.

Signs your windows need replacing

Condensation between the panes (not on the inside surface) means the sealed unit has failed and lost its insulating gas fill. Difficulty opening or closing, visible frame rot in timber windows, and draughts around a closed window are the other common signs it's time to replace rather than repair.

Can you fit triple glazing?
Some specialists can supply and fit triple glazing. It is heavier and may require specific frames, so a window-specialist will advise on suitability. Share the age of the property, access, and what you want to change so the Window Specialist can plan the right approach.
